| IncidentReporting is a MediaWiki extension for moving incident reports from wikitext to database tables. There are a variety of Cross-site Scripting issues, though all of them require elevated permissions. Some are available to anyone who has the `editincidents` right, some are available to those who can edit interface messages (typically administrators and interface admins), and one is available to those who can edit LocalSettings.php. These issues have been addressed in commit `43896a4` and all users are advised to upgrade. Users unable to upgrade should prevent access to the Special:IncidentReports page. |

| Icinga Reporting is the central component for reporting related functionality in the monitoring web frontend and framework Icinga Web 2. A vulnerability present in versions 0.10.0 through 1.0.2 allows to set up a template that allows to embed arbitrary Javascript. This enables the attacker to act on behalf of the user, if the template is being previewed; and act on behalf of the headless browser, if a report using the template is printed to PDF. This issue has been resolved in version 1.0.3 of Icinga Reporting. As a workaround, review all templates and remove suspicious settings. |

| savg-sanitizer is a PHP SVG/XML sanitizer. Prior to version 0.22.0, the sanitization logic in the cleanXlinkHrefs method only searches for lower-case attribute name, which allows to by-pass the isHrefSafeValue check. As a result this allows cross-site scripting or linking to external domains. This issue has been patched in version 0.22.0. |
